Before interviewing for a customer service agent job, be sure to:

  1. Familiarize yourself with the company's products/services and customer base.
  2. Highlight your communication skills, patience, and ability to problem solve.
  3. Provide examples of previous customer service experience.
  4. Demonstrate your ability to work well under pressure.
  5. Prepare to discuss how you handle difficult customers or situations.
